Marky_D_Sahd wrote:
I will boycott H&P (BTW boycotts are ALWAYS legal.  There is no such animal as an "Illegal" boycott.  As long as people are free to choose to buy a product, they will be free to choose to NOT buy that product.  Right?)

However, I don't think that boycotting Compuquick or S.Hut is a positive step.  Surely if we all successfully boycott H&P products, the problem will take care of itself:  The distributers will stop carying them.

Boycotts, like all protests, however, cause damage.  Boycotting the last few Amiga distributors seems like too much damage, to me.  Buying AMINET SET XXVII from Software Hut does not help to support H&P, but does help support the "good guys".

So, yeah, e-mail the distributors with your concerns, boycott H&P products, but DON'T shoot the bystanders.


I agree with you! It isn't the vendors fault that they are caught up in the cross fire. All that needs to happen is a complete boycot of H&P products. If you don't agree with a vendor selling Amithlon, fine don't buy it! But there is no reason to boycot the vendor because if it, otherwise you will just put them out of buisness, and that does no good for anyone.

What a complete bag-o-shyte.  The situation that is.

On trying to give a neutral opinion (which is quite hard), I think it would be wrong to boycott the resellers and dealers that have worked hard, and have remained in the Amiga market for this long.  Even Haage & Partner have done some nice stuff - ArtEffect, OS Upgrades etc. - but I think they have well and truly overstepped the mark on this one.

I agree with the others that have gone before me in saying that if anything should be targetted by a boycott then it's H&P's products, which would hopefully send the message that this kind of behaviour is not acceptable.

I don't use Amithlon, but from what I have read and seen it looks like a damn good product, and can only result in more users gaining an Amiga experience and perhaps staying in the community (i.e. growth).  BM deserves to be rewarded for his excellent work.

What I find odd is why Bernie can't continue to sell his product?  I am not up on law so forgive me here.  The issue is over H&P violating Amiga's IP, so wouldn't it be possible for Amiga Inc. to issue a seperate licence to Bernie so that he could continue with his work (Amithlon), and distribute through alternative channels?  After all the issue is with H&P selling an illegal version of the product.

So to clarify, why can't Amiga and Bernie get together and cut out the middle man?

As a quick note on the Team AMIGA posting.  I must admit that I cringed when I first saw it.  Whoever heard of the "miggy pyramid" before?  A lot of it reads like a rant and was put together in 5 minutes.  It would be a lot better IMO if the author sat down and came up with a well worded and calm statement, currently it makes them look quite unprofessional.  When you do cut through the noise though, there are some very valid points there.

As for the flag, I'm not  going into that, suffice to say I don't think there is any need as flag or not we all know who they are referring to.

Anyway, that's my take on the situation.  I hope something can be worked out for Bernie's and the Amiga Markets sake.

Quote

Basically it started out as comp.sys.amiga.advocacy cheerleaders and now it is just a stale talking shop.

Not quite. It was started in Fidonet AMIGA by Rick Lembree, sysop of Harbor Lights BBS.
I'll agree that it's now a stale talking shop.
Rick died some months later and the mantle was taken up by Asha Develder and Gary Peake. When Gary moved to Seattle to start work for Amiga.com he passed the coordinator job on to Skal Loret. AFAIK Gary still owns the owlnet.net domain name.
